Scale Clerk
Location: Detroit, MI
Ferrous Processing and Trading (FPT) is one of North America’s premier processors, buyers, sellers and recyclers of scrap metals of all kinds and is a key supplier to the metals industry of North America. FPT is a wholly-owned business of Cleveland-Cliffs and has an immediate opportunity for a Scale Clerk at one of our Detroit, MI locations. The Scale Clerk is responsible for weighing all inbound and outbound vehicles, inspecting loose loads, directing them to proper unloading areas, and assisting in the details of purchases.
Summary of Responsibilities:
Ensure adherence to safety standards including use of required personal protective equipment (PPE), remove hazards as identified, and maintain cleanliness of the site.
Accurately inspect all materials ensuring correct weights, materials description, and grade for all inbound and outbound loads.
Determine the grade of the material, enter it into the inventory system, and direct to proper location.
Operate & maintain mobile equipment including but not limited to forklifts, skid steers.
Provide day-to-day training and guidance to develop our team to its fullest potential.
Answer customer questions about materials, pricing and procedures.
Maintain records as required.
Research, compare, and evaluate local markets.
Manage, arrange, and schedule pickups and deliveries with carriers.
Assist with processing as needed, periodically operate & maintain equipment.
Maintain scale house and keep grounds organized.
Operate scale computer, applying correct material and inventory codes.
Prepare proper paperwork for shipments.
Communicate effectively with transportation, customers, management, and yard employees.
Interact with customers or drivers to direct or assist them.
Ensure quality of inbound and outbound materials.

Ferrous Processing and Trading is a subsidiary of Cleveland-Cliffs Inc., the largest flat-rolled steel company and the largest iron ore pellet producer in North America. Cleveland-Cliffs is vertically integrated from mined raw materials, direct reduced iron, and ferrous scrap to primary steelmaking and downstream finishing, stamping, tooling, and tubing.
